Aishwarya Rai’s entry into the film industry was anything but conventional. She debuted not in a glitzy Bollywood masala film, but in Mani Ratnam’s Tamil political drama Iruvar (1997). Playing a character inspired by the late actress and politician J. Jayalalithaa, Aishwarya displayed a rawness that surprised critics who expected her to be merely a decorative piece.
